Output af66a356085b4e3556f425c2909d79207a53f8098b98594c433b81f4e4069826:0

value
24690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 798299c136656c68687e6ea4506321421dbd457c OP_EQUAL
address
MJyeSvwHnr9cxjTtmUkZJRQ25yTLgkn7Jf
transaction
af66a356085b4e3556f425c2909d79207a53f8098b98594c433b81f4e4069826
spent
true